Базовые принципы работы Linux для новичков

Базовые принципы работы Linux для новичков

Linux является собой операционной систему с свободным оригинальным кодом. Система зародилась в 1991 году благодаря финскому программисту Линусу Торвальдсу. Ныне Vulkan casino используется на серверах, индивидуальных ПК, мобильных аппаратах и встроенных системах.

Открытый код даёт возможность любому пользователю познавать, корректировать и делиться ОС. Создатели со всего мира делают участие в совершенствование центрального компонента и программных решений. Данный способ предоставляет значительную надёжность и защищённость.

ОС даровая для применения. Юзеры не отдают за разрешения и имеют возможность устанавливать вулкан казино на любое объём компьютеров. Экономия денег делает продукт привлекательным для учебных заведений и малого бизнеса.

Гибкость регулировки выделяет платформу среди конкурентов. Владельцы выбирают графический интерфейс, комплект программ и настройки использования по своему желанию. Варианты индивидуализации почти безграничны.

Что это за ОС и чем она разнится от Windows

Организация ОС строится на основах Unix. Ядро системы управляет аппаратными мощностями, а клиентские приложения работают в изолированном пространстве. Модульная организация предоставляет надёжность и ограждение от ошибок.

Схема дистрибуции существенно разнится от закрытых вариантов. Первоначальный исходник доступен любому интересующимся для исследования и переделки. Windows использует проприетарную схему проектирования.

Файловая структура выстроена иным образом. Вместо разделов C:, D:, E: применяется объединённое структуру каталогов с корнем в /. Служебные документы хранятся в /etc, приложения в /usr/bin, домашние каталоги в /home.

Контроль утилитами реализуется через пакетные управляющие программы. Размещение и модернизация программ реализуется централизовано из репозиториев. В казино онлайн юзеры загружают установщики с разнообразных веб-страниц.

Права к ресурсам устроены жёстче. Рядовой пользователь не способен корректировать системные документы без специального увеличения полномочий.

Варианты Linux

Сборка является собой полную комплектацию операционной ОС. Всякая комплектация объединяет ядро, комплект приложений, визуальную оболочку и возможности регулировки.

Ubuntu считается востребованным вариантом для новичков. Сборка предлагает несложную установку, понятный интерфейс и подробную руководство. Версии с долгосрочной сопровождением принимают актуализации в срок пяти лет.

Fedora сфокусирована на современные решения и последнее софтверное обеспечение. Специалисты оперативно интегрируют современные фичи. Дистрибутив годится активным пользователям, хотящим работать с новейшими инструментами.

Debian прославлен устойчивостью и надёжностью. Пакеты подвергаются глубокое проверку перед добавлением в хранилище. Системные специалисты обычно определяют казино вулкан для критически важных платформ.

Arch создан для опытных юзеров. Установка подразумевает мануальной настройки через командную строку. Идеология версии означает тотальный надзор над ОС.

Mint создан на основе Ubuntu с упором на удобство и предварительно установленными декодерами для медиаконтента.

Файловая структура Linux

Структура папок стартует с основной папки /. Любые документы, директории и элементы помещаются в рамках этого единого структуры. Отказ от символов разделов упрощает передвижение.

Директория /bin включает главные исполняемые утилиты. Инструкции ls, cp, mv и прочие ключевые утилиты присутствуют в этом месте и доступны каждому владельцам.

Папка /etc содержит параметрические файлы. Опции сети, настройки демонов и служебные параметры находятся в этой папке. Управляющие правят файлы для изменения функционирования вулкан казино.

Папка /home вмещает индивидуальные директории юзеров. Любой аккаунт приобретает отдельную директорию для файлов и параметров приложений.

Директория /var создан для переменных данных. Логи платформы, буфер приложений и временные данные размещаются здесь.

Директория /tmp используется для временного размещения. Файлы самостоятельно очищаются при перезагрузке.

Монтирование устройств реализуется в /mnt или /media. Внешние носители добавляются как дочерние директории.

Терминал и командная строка: зачем они необходимы и как с ними наладить работу

Командная оболочка открывает прямой связь к системе через символьные команды. Интерфейс обеспечивает возможность производить задачи быстрее визуальных приложений. Различные административные функции требуют взаимодействия в командной оболочке.

Команда ls отображает список папки. Ключ -l демонстрирует детальную данные о файлах. Передвижение по каталогам осуществляется через cd с указанием расположения.

Создание документов реализуется утилитой touch. Удаление выполняется через rm, дублирование через cp. Транспортировка и смену имени осуществляет инструкция mv.

Полномочия к файлам изменяются командой chmod. Команда обрабатывает числительные или буквенные форматы. Хозяина данных модифицирует chown с заданием владельца.

Просмотр текстовых данных реализуется через cat или less. Начальная отображает весь данные, следующая даёт возможность просматривать постранично. Изменение осуществляется в nano или vim.

Нахождение файлов реализует утилита find с указаниями адреса. Нахождение текста в содержимом данных реализует grep. Автодополнение по Tab облегчает ввод в казино вулкан.

Пользователи и объединения: концепция защищённости и регулирование к данным

Система распределяет разрешения владельцев для ограждения данных. Всякий профиль приобретает неповторимый номер UID. Стандартные пользователи не способны корректировать критические данные.

Суперпользователь root обладает полными привилегиями. Учётная запись позволяет производить любые манипуляции без барьеров. Регулярная деятельность от учётной записи root не не желательна.

Инструкция sudo на время увеличивает права. Юзер выполняет системные операции, указывая свой код. После окончания полномочия восстанавливаются к стандартному состоянию.

Группы связывают владельцев для группового взаимодействия. Данные принадлежат хозяину и объединению. Конфигурация полномочий контролирует чтение, запись и запуск.

Управление пользователями содержит процедуры:

  • Генерация аккаунта утилитой useradd
  • Уничтожение через userdel
  • Изменение ключа доступа программой passwd
  • Внесение в объединение инструкцией usermod с ключом -aG
  • Вывод коллективов инструкцией groups

Файл /etc/passwd хранит информацию об учётных записях в казино онлайн.

Программные модули и аппаратура: как Linux контактирует с компонентами

Ядро системы содержит предустановленные модули управления для большинства устройств. Автоматическое определение компонентов происходит при запуске. Видеокарты, сетевые контроллеры и звуковые карты как правило работают сразу.

Элементы ядра являются собой динамические драйверы. Инструкция lsmod выводит перечень активных компонентов. Подключение свежего элемента выполняется через modprobe, извлечение через rmmod.

Закрытые драйверы предполагают специальной установки. Компании NVIDIA и AMD предоставляют закрытые драйверы для предельной скорости. Установка выполняется через модульные системы управления или программы установки.

Утилита lspci выводит активные PCI-адаптеры. Инструмент lsusb выводит сведения об USB-устройствах. Подробные сведения представлены в каталогах /proc и /sys.

Каталог /dev содержит служебные объекты устройств. Жёсткие хранилища представлены как /dev/sda, тома индексируются /dev/sda1, /dev/sda2. Работа выполняется через просмотр и изменение в данные файлы.

Инструкция dmesg показывает уведомления центрального компонента о установленном оборудовании и содействует диагностировать проблемы в вулкан казино.

Инсталляция приложений

Пакетные системы управления автоматизируют размещение софтверного приложений. Платформа получает пакеты из источников, верифицирует требования и регулирует программы. Объединённый метод оптимизирует контроль софтом.

Менеджер APT применяется в версиях на фундаменте Debian. Инструкция apt install размещает программу с самостоятельной подгрузкой компонентов. Обновление реестра производится через apt update, обновление приложений через apt upgrade.

Менеджер DNF эксплуатируется в Fedora и производных сборках. Инсталляция программы выполняется инструкцией dnf install, стирание через dnf remove.

Менеджер Pacman применяется в Arch и основанных платформах. Утилита pacman -S устанавливает пакет, pacman -R удаляет.

Snap-модули вмещают утилиту со комплектом компонентами. Защищённая окружение предоставляет защищённость. Размещение осуществляется инструкцией snap install.

Flatpak предоставляет другой стандарт кроссплатформенных модулей. Программы выполняются в песочнице с сниженным правами. Утилита flatpak install получает приложения из Flathub в казино вулкан.

Задачи и сервисы: как просматривать, прекращать и перезагружать задачи

Программы являются собой работающие программы в платформе. Любой задача имеет особый идентификатор PID. Операционная платформа назначает ресурсы между активными программами.

Инструкция ps отображает перечень активных программ. Ключ aux показывает каждый программы с развёрнутой данными. Инструмент top демонстрирует процессы в текущем времени.

Прекращение программы реализуется утилитой kill с вводом PID. Сообщение SIGTERM просит программу правильно остановиться. Сигнал SIGKILL безусловно убивает программу.

Службы выполняются в фоновом формате и запускаются без участия пользователя. Инструмент systemd администрирует демонами через команду systemctl.

Ключевые операции со демонами:

  • Старт командой systemctl start
  • Остановка через systemctl stop
  • Перезагрузка командой systemctl restart
  • Отображение состояния через systemctl status
  • Установка автоматического старта утилитой systemctl enable
  • Отключение через systemctl disable

Команда journalctl демонстрирует журналы сервисов в казино онлайн.

Прикладные рекомендации новичку

Приступайте изучение с дружелюбного дистрибутива. Ubuntu или Linux Mint дают лёгкую размещение и понятный интерфейс. Оконные инструменты позволяют производить операции без консольной терминала.

Сформируйте страховочную дубликат критичных информации перед тестами. Изучение платформы способно вызвать к проблемам настройки. Систематическое резервное копирование сохранит информацию.

Осваивайте консоль поэтапно. Начните с основных команд передвижения и работы с файлами. Тренировка фиксирует понимание результативнее изучения справочной информации.

Используйте официальную руководство дистрибутива. Wiki-страницы включают решения стандартных затруднений. Площадки пользователей способствуют получить ответы на запросы.

Обновляйте ОС регулярно. Новые компоненты имеют улучшения безопасности и свежие опции.

Не оперируйте регулярно от учётной записи администратора. Применяйте sudo лишь для системных операций. Сужение привилегий уменьшает вероятность поломки системы.

Экспериментируйте с разными утилитами. Хранилища содержат тысячи бесплатных программ. Тестирование софта содействует отыскать идеальные утилиты.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top